Clinical Resource: Success Story: Debby Linton Ferguson

Exercise is a must for longtime marathoner and mom, Debby Linton Ferguson. On May 4, Debby will be striding for a deeply personal cause – a cure for cancer at the 4th Annual Be A Part of the Cure Walk to benefit the UAMS Winthrop P. Rockefeller Cancer Institute. Cancer has hit Debby’s family hard. Her father, mother and grandmother all battled the disease, and Debby is currently battling a recurrence of breast cancer. But thanks to the expert care they received at UAMS Health, Debby’s dad enjoyed 30 precious cancer-free years, and her mother continues to enjoy an active and cancer-free life.

“My family received decades of bonus time together thanks to the excellent care provided at the UAMS Winthrop P. Rockefeller Cancer Institute. We naturally feel driven to do something to give back to those who have given us so much. The Be A Part of the Cure Walk is a fun and healthy way we can all support Arkansas’ cancer center in finding a cure. I hope you will join us on May 4.”

– Debby Linton Ferguson, Be A Part of the Cure Walk Volunteer
